Menstrual Problems of Women in Bangladesh
Bangladeshi women suffer from menstrual problems such as dysmenorrhoea, menorrhagia, light and heavy bleeding during menstruation, and irregular period and are constantly worried if they menstrual flow is not a “normal” amount.
